Dear linux powerpc Maintainers and Users,
recently I have tried to compile a new kernel on a Debian sarge ppc
system (PowerBook5,6 MacRISC3 Power Macintosh).
The build system bailed out with
BOOTCC arch/powerpc/boot/4xx.o
cc1: error: bad value (440) for -mcpu= switch
make[1]: *** [arch/powerpc/boot/4xx.o] Fehler 1
I have tracked this a few steps and the attached patch made the compile for me
as my compiler gcc-Version 3.3.5 (Debian 1:3.3.5-13)
cannot produce code for 4xx it seems.
The "ARCH=ppc64" I have came about also looked wrong, but I do not know
if this part of the patch is really necessary.
It is just a workaround, as I have no insight of what is really going wrong.
